Understanding Your Right to Compensation in Tennessee

If a close family member, such as a spouse, parent, or child, has died, your situation can be all the more hard if the death that happened in Tennessee was because someone else was acting in a criminal or negligent manner. In most instances, the family of the victim may be able to file a lawsuit for wrongful death.

Law about Wrongful Death in Tennessee

Only people who are extremely closely related to the victim may file for wrongful death in Memphis.

The laws generally say that only the immediate family of the deceased have the authority to sue.

If you win your Wrongful Death case, you will likely be entitled to damages meant to compensate for funeral costs, medical care the deceased received prior to death, loss of companionship, and maybe punitive damages.

Life in Memphis

Memphis, Tennessee has something for everyone. Popular family attractions include Graceland, Main Street Trolley, AutoZone Park, and the Gibson Factory. Memphis is also known as a city rich in history, so there are many museums to see! Some museums include the National Civil Rights Museum, Stax Museum of American Soul Music, Mississippi River Museum at Mud Island, and the Memphis Rock 'n' Soul Museum.

Amongst all the cities in the United States, Memphis is deemed the twentieth largest city in the U.S. Along with Nashville, Memphis is known to be one of Tennessee's most exciting and metropolitan cities with a population of around 1,316,100 people. Downtown Memphis lies along the Mississippi River and is home to many companies and law firms.
